Continents Loss Of Dense Matter To Oceans Helps Keep Continents Above The Mantle

Posted by: RSS In: Topix.com

“It appears that our planet has continents because we have an active hydrosphere, so if we want to find a hydrosphere on distant planets, perhaps we should look for continents.”

The research finds continents lose more than 20 percent of their initial mass via chemical reactions involving the Earth’s crust, water and atmosphere. via Science Daily
